    HOULTON — Another new store opened on North Street this week with the launch of The Cigaret Shopper in a storefront between Rentown and Varney Agency.

    “We opened in Presque Isle the first part of July and it’s done quite well,” said owner Ken Nagle. “So, we decided to open one here in Houlton.”
    Nagle is no stranger to Houlton: the son of Bob and Molly Nagle, Ken grew up right down the street from his new business in the building that’s currently home to First Citizen’s Bank.
    “Dad bought Reid’s Confectionary and our family operated that in Houlton until 1987,” explained Nagle.
    The Cigaret Shopper stores originally started as a division of Reid’s Confectionary, and over the years, the company opened nine of the tobacco specialty shops.
    Nagle said set-up at the Houlton shop has gone smoothly, and managers have been hired. Chris Beaulieu is the operations manager and Chris Putnam is the store manager. A grand opening will be announced in the near future.
    The goal, said Nagle, is to offer a variety of products for a variety of customers.
    “We carry the full gamut of tobacco products,” he said. “We have everything from the least expensive products to $10 premi um cigars.”
